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

To determine whether functional electrical stimulation (FES) promotes neurological and physical recovery in patients with spinal cord injury (SCI).

The researchers will investigate the extent of functional recovery in patients with spinal cord injury who receive functional electrical stimulation in the upper extremities compared with patients who do not receive FES.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

A randomized, controlled, single-blinded, in-subject controlled (A-B type) trial will be performed in patients with SCI receiving an upper extremities non-FES assisted exercise protocol compared with patients receiving upper extremities ergometry in combination with FES. Neurological and functional outcome measures will be obtained at baseline (time 0), after 1st 4 months of intervention (4 months), after 1 month washout (5 months),after 2nd 4 months intervention (9 months), and 3 month after completing the last intervention (12 months).

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

No FES Cycling

Group Type SHAM_COMPARATOR

Non-FES Upper Extremity Exercise

Intervention Type DEVICE

While undergoing the non-FES exercise intervention, the subjects will receive a specific, individualized exercise regimen, consisting of strengthening, stretching, splinting and any other therapeutic interventions that do not use electrical stimulation. Than a 1 month washout period,the subjects will remain seated in their primary wheelchair throughout the treatment. The subjects will exercise for 60 minutes/session, three times a week for 4 months.

FES Cycling

Group Type ACTIVE_COMPARATOR

RT300-SLSA, from Restorative Therapies, Inc.

Intervention Type DEVICE

They will undergo 4 months of FES assisted upper extremity ergometry followed by 1 month was out period, than by 4 months of a specific, individualized, non FES assisted exercise regimen

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Male, Female, age 18-55, all ethnic groups
* Spinal Cord Injury, traumatic and non-traumatic
* C1-C6 neurological level
* ASIA class A-B
* Chronic injury \> 12 months and \< 20 years from the injury
* No upper-extremity electrical stimulation in the previous 4 weeks
* Subjects are medically stable, with no recent (1 month or less) inpatient admission for acute medical or surgical issues
* Baseline physical activity is kept stable
* Pain and antispasticity medications dose are kept stable
* Subjects are legally able to make their own health care decisions

Exclusion Criteria

* Associated lower motor neuron/peripheral nerve injury in the C1-C6 levels
* Presence of pacemaker
* Presence of cancer
* History of seizures
* Women who are pregnant
